Lastly, we reject Yaana Systems' suggestion that we are unable to exercising the extraterritorial jurisdiction that Congress expressly supplied in part 503 in the RAY BAUM'S Act, which applies only to communications gained in The us. Yaana Systems cites no specific treaty obligation the statutory language contravenes, nor other lawful barrier to the Fee's exercise in the lawful authority offered it by Congress, and we have been aware about none. In addition, the Fee's ongoing work with our Worldwide counterparts on caller ID spoofing challenges in a variety of fora is not really inconsistent Together with the jurisdictional framework established forth within the statute.

Though, as Twilio points out, Brief Codes might be more unlikely to be used by someone or entity sending messages in reference to malicious caller ID spoofing as the registration and administration approach make “the sender of a brief code SMS [ ] much much easier to discover compared to person of a 10-digit range,” this protection will not be absolute. Twilio by itself admits that it's not unattainable to spoof a brief Code. Customers have complained about doable Brief Code spoofing, and many reporting implies that Quick Codes is often hacked which could lead to spoofing. Nevertheless, CTIA expresses worry regarding the Fee getting that the definition of “text concept” for applications of our Reality in Caller ID regulations includes messages sent to or from an individual or entity employing Shorter Codes. CTIA argues that there's no technical evidence inside the report that spoofing of Shorter Codes can be done or has happened. CTIA also argues that an absence of discover below the Administrative Method Act for which include Small Codes in the definition of textual content information and an absence of reference to Shorter Codes during the RAY BAUM'S Act counsel in favor of not such as messages sent from a person or entity using Short Codes in the definition of textual content information. We find CTIA's arguments for being misplaced.
